487ZB Compensation for acquisition of property
          (1) If the operation of section 487ZA would result in an acquisition of
              property from a person otherwise than on just terms, the
              Commonwealth is liable to pay a reasonable amount of
              compensation to the person.
          (2) If the Commonwealth and the person do not agree on the amount
              of the compensation, the person may institute proceedings in a
              court of competent jurisdiction for the recovery from the
              Commonwealth of such reasonable amount of compensation as the
              court determines.
          (3) In this section:









               acquisition of property has the same meaning as in
               paragraph 51(xxxi) of the Constitution.
               just terms has the same meaning as in paragraph 51(xxxi) of the
               Constitution.
